Go Back

Creamy Tomato Basil Parmesan Soup

A warm, comforting soup that combines ripe tomatoes, heavy cream, and fresh basil for a rich flavor profile that delights with every spoonful.
Prep Time 10 minutes
Cook Time 20 minutes
Total Time 30 minutes
Servings: 4 servings
Course: Appetizer, Soup
Cuisine: American, Comfort Food
Calories: 200

Ingredients
  

Main ingredients
  • 2 tablespoons olive oil for sautéing; substitute with butter for a richer flavor.
  • 1 onion chopped adds a savory base; shallots can be a milder alternative.
  • 4 cloves garlic minced; provides aromatic depth; garlic powder can work in a pinch.
  • 2 cans 14.5 oz diced tomatoes the star of the dish; fresh tomatoes can replace canned for a fresher taste.
  • 1 cup vegetable broth adds flavor; chicken broth works too for a heartier option.
  • 1 cup heavy cream ensures creaminess; use coconut cream for a lighter, dairy-free version.
  • 1 cup fresh basil chopped; brings freshness; dried basil can substitute, but use sparingly.
  • 1/2 cup grated Parmesan cheese infuses a savory richness; nutritional yeast can be a non-dairy alternative.
  • Salt and pepper to taste; remember to adjust after the soup simmers.

Method
 

Cooking Instructions
  1. In a large pot, heat olive oil over medium heat. Add chopped onion and sauté until translucent.
  2. Add minced garlic and cook for an additional minute.
  3. Stir in the diced tomatoes and vegetable broth; bring to a simmer.
  4. Lower the heat and mix in heavy cream, chopped basil, and grated Parmesan cheese.
  5. Season with salt and pepper.
  6. Use an immersion blender to puree the soup to your desired consistency.
  7. Serve warm, garnished with additional basil if desired.

Notes

For extra flavor, consider adding spices like red pepper flakes. Serve with grilled cheese sandwiches or a drizzle of pesto on top. Adjust consistency with broth if needed.